{current && }
      
      
        
          
            
              
                {props.post.time.toLocaleString(i18n.languages)}
              
              
                {props.post.author.nickname}
              
            
          
          {more != null ? (
            
              
          ) : null}
        
        
          
            
          
          {(() => {
            const { content } = props.post;
            if (content.type === 'text') {
              return content.text;
            } else {
              return (
                
              );
            }
          })()}
        
      
      {more != null && more.isOpen ? (
        <>
          
            
          {deleteDialog ? (
             {
                toggleDeleteDialog();
                more.toggle();
              }}
              onConfirm={more.onDelete}
            />
          ) : null}
        >
      ) : null}
    
  );
};
export default TimelineItem;